Overview of Piston Bolt Usage in Global Industries
Piston bolts play a crucial role across various industries, primarily in the automotive sector. The demand for these components is forged by the need for durability and reliability under high stress. According to a recent market analysis, the global piston bolt market is projected to reach USD 1.5 billion by 2026. This growth is largely driven by the expansion of electric and hybrid vehicles.
In aerospace, piston bolts secure vital components, ensuring safety and performance. Data suggests that the aviation sector is increasingly adopting advanced materials for piston bolt manufacturing, enhancing strength while reducing weight. However, challenges remain. Ensuring the precision of each bolt is critical, and even minor defects can lead to catastrophic failures.
The construction industry also utilizes piston bolts, especially in machinery like excavators and cranes. Reports indicate a steady demand for high-quality bolts in this sector as infrastructure projects rise globally. Nevertheless, manufacturers must address issues related to supply chain disruptions. As industries evolve, so must the manufacturers who support them.

Quality Standards and Certifications in Piston Bolt Manufacturing
The manufacturing of piston bolts demands rigorous quality standards. These components must endure extreme conditions in engines. Manufacturers should adhere to specified certifications to guarantee product reliability. Certifications like ISO 9001 showcase a commitment to maintaining quality in production processes. These standards help in building trust with global buyers.
Quality assurance involves regular testing of materials and finished products. Inspections during manufacturing ensure that the bolts meet mechanical and dimensional specifications. Manufacturers need to invest in qualified personnel. Skilled technicians can detect defects that machines might overlook. The experience in quality control is critical for producing dependable piston bolts.
However, not all manufacturers maintain these standards. Some may cut corners to reduce costs. This leads to variability in quality. Buyers should remain vigilant and seek manufacturers with a proven track record. Understanding the certifications and standards can empower global buyers in their procurement decisions.
